DC.js是一个出色的JavaScript库,用于在浏览器,移动设备中进行数据分析,最终有助于创建数据可视化.数据可视化是以图形或图形格式呈现数据.数据可视化的主要目标是通过统计图形,图表和信息图形清晰有效地传达信息.可以使用不同的JavaScript框架在常规Web甚至移动应用程序中开发和集成数据可视化.
什么是DC.js?
DC.js是一个用于探索大型多维数据集的图表库.它依赖于D3.js引擎以CSS友好的SVG格式呈现图表.它允许渲染复杂的数据可视化,并具有设计的仪表板,其中包含条形图,散点图,热图等.DC.js可与 Crossfilter 一起用于数据操作. DC.js允许单个(大)数据集通过许多互连图表可视化,并带有高级自动过滤选项.
为什么我们需要DC.js?
一般来说,数据可视化是一个非常复杂的过程,在客户端执行它需要额外的技能. DC.js使我们能够使用更简单的编程模型创建几乎任何类型的复杂数据可视化.它是一个开源的,非常容易上传的JavaScript库,它允许我们在很短的时间内实现整洁的自定义可视化.
DC.js图表是数据驱动的,非常活跃.此外,它使用 Crossfilter Library 为用户交互提供即时反馈.
DC.js功能
DC. js是最好的数据可视化框架之一,它可用于生成简单和复杂的可视化.一些显着的功能列在下面和下面;
非常灵活.
易于使用.
快速渲染图表.
支持大型多维数据集.
开源JavaScript库.
Dc.js优点
DC.js是一个开源项目,它需要较少的代码与其他人相比.它具有以下优点和减号;
出色的数据可视化.
执行图形过滤.
快速创建图表和仪表板.
创建高度互动的仪表板.
在下一章中,我们将了解如何在我们的系统上安装D3.js.